Prep Time:20 mins
Cook Time:30 mins
Total Time:50 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 1 lb Ground beef (80/20 blend)
  • 1 tsp Salt
  • 1 tsp Black pepper
  • 1 tsp Garlic powder
  • 1 tsp Paprika
  • 4 pieces Cheddar cheese slices
  • 2 medium Yellow onions
  • 2 tbsp Butter
  • 1 tbsp Brown sugar
  • 1 cup BBQ sauce
  • 2 tbsp Sriracha
  • 4 pieces Burger buns
  • 4 pieces Lettuce leaves
  • 4 pieces Tomato slices
  • 1 cup Pickles (optional)
  • 1 tbsp Vegetable oil

Directions

Step 1

In a mixing bowl, combine the ground beef with salt, black pepper, garlic powder, and paprika. Gently mix until just combined, being careful not to overwork the meat. Divide into 4 equal portions and shape into patties approximately 3/4 inch thick. Make a small indentation in the center of each patty to prevent puffing during cooking.

Step 2

Peel and thinly slice the onions. In a skillet over medium heat, melt the butter and add the sliced onions. Cook for 10-15 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the onions are soft and golden brown. Stir in the brown sugar and cook for an additional 2 minutes. Remove from heat and set the caramelized onions aside.

Step 3

In a small bowl, mix the BBQ sauce and Sriracha together to create the spicy BBQ sauce. Adjust the level of spice to your preference by adding more or less Sriracha.

Step 4

Heat a large skillet or grill pan over medium-high heat and lightly brush it with vegetable oil. Add the burger patties and cook for 3-4 minutes per side, or until they reach your desired doneness. In the last minute of cooking, place a slice of cheddar cheese on each patty and cover the pan to melt the cheese.

Step 5

Lightly toast the burger buns on the skillet or grill for 1-2 minutes until golden brown.

Step 6

Assemble the burgers by spreading the spicy BBQ sauce on both halves of the buns. Place a lettuce leaf on the bottom bun, followed by a tomato slice, the cheeseburger patty, a generous scoop of caramelized onions, and pickles if desired. Top with the other half of the bun.

Step 7

Serve immediately with your favorite sides, such as fries or coleslaw. Enjoy your Old School Meets New Cheesy Onion Spicy BBQ Burger!
